Definitions for "Advisory"
A bulletin issued by NWS offices which alerts the public to a non-severe, yet significant weather event which is expected to remain below the warning criteria, but may still cause significant inconvenience. These events can produce life and property damage if caution is not exercised. See Air Stagnation or Pollution Advisory, Blowing Snow Advisory, Dense Fog Advisory, Freezing Rain or Drizzle Advisory, Heat Advisory, Lake Snow Advisory, Snow Advisory, Urban and Small Stream Flood Advisory, Wind Advisory, Wind Chill Advisory, Winter Weather Advisory.
Statements issued by a weather service that discuss weather situations of inconvenience that do not carry the danger of warning criteria, but, if not observed, could lead to hazardous situations. Some examples include snow advisories stating possible slick streets, or fog advisories for patchy fog condition causing temporary restrictions to visibility. See also special weather statements.
